 Suspect Captured After Escape From Phoenix Police Facility

Authorities have reported that an armed robbery suspect who escaped from a Phoenix police facility early Friday morning is back in custody.

The suspect, 20-year-old Tyler Woodward escaped a police facility near Central Avenue and Elwood Street, north of Broadway Road, around 1 a.m.


At approximately 1 p.m., police said Woodward was taken into custody about a mile away, near Seventh Street and Elwood.
